Light travels with a speed of $3\times{10}^{8}$ {ms}^{-1}. The distance travelled by light in $1$ femto second is:

  1. $0.03mm$
  2. $0.003mm$
  3. $3mm$
  4. $0.0003mm$
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

Distance = speed * time. Speed = 3 * 10^8 m/s. Time = 1 femtosecond = 10^-15 s. Distance = 3 * 10^8 * 10^-15 = 3 * 10^-7 meters. Converting to mm: (3 * 10^-7 m) * (1000 mm / 1 m) = 3 * 10^-4 mm = 0.0003 mm.
